Job Title: Sr. Embedded Software Engineer

Location: Remote

Pay Range: $100,000 - $130,000 + Bonus Eligible

 

Who we are: Lynx delivers modular, open standards–based software that transforms how high-assurance, mission-critical edge systems are built, deployed, and maintained. Our secure edge computing solutions enable innovation and operational excellence in the world’s most demanding environments, from aerospace and defense to commercial and industrial systems. We partner across industries including automotive, medical, and critical infrastructure to deliver tailored solutions aligned with each customer’s mission and operational requirements. Our key products and services are: 

  • MOSA.ic: LYNX MOSA.ic™ is a modular software framework and architecture purpose-built for mission-critical edge computing. Based on the Modular Open Systems Approach (MOSA), it provides a flexible foundation for building secure, scalable, and certifiable edge systems.
  • LYNX MOSA.ic.AI: LYNX MOSA.ic.AI is a unified CPU and GPU software platform that enables deterministic, certifiable deployment of AI and advanced workloads in mission-critical edge systems. It brings control, performance, and lifecycle governance together, allowing AI to operate predictably within safety-critical environments without compromising certification or system integrity. 
  • CoreSuite 2.0: CoreSuite 2.0 is Lynx’s safety-critical GPU for graphics enablement framework designed for mission-critical edge computing systems. It provides hardware-accelerated graphics, visualization, and video processing capabilities that can be certified for high-assurance systems.
  • Services: Lynx Services is Lynx’s professional services organization that helps customers design, integrate, certify, deploy, and maintain safety- and security-critical systems. It supports industries like aerospace, defense, automotive, and industrial computing through consulting, engineering, integration, and lifecycle support, reducing development risk and accelerating certification in standards-driven, mission-critical environment.


What you will be doing:

  • Working under our professional services division.  This allows opportunities to work on a vast array of differing technologies, including Lynx’s key products, many additional customer requirements, and open source software.
  • Be an embedded Linux expert (kernel, CPU-architecture, security, general device-drivers, and performance optimization) in the customer engineering team and enable customers in doing their embedded SW development.
    • Design, develop, and refactor real-time software architectures and modular software components.
    • Reproduce, isolate and debug complex low-level problems that may span interfaces between hardware and software.
  • Collaborate with the customer and internal teams to always enhance the overall project experience.
    • Contribute to the overall product design to help customers through various aspects of their product lifecycle.
    • Working closely with the team to ensure the project deadlines are met and risks/issues are proactively identified and communicated to the customer.
    • Ensure high quality of our deliverables.
    • Developing technical proposals to help customers make technical decisions.

 

  • Perform additional job duties as assigned.

 

All applicants must have:

  • 3-5+ years of experience building and shipping embedded systems using Linux.
  • Proficiency in Linux kernel customization, device driver design and development and at least one or more build environments such as Yocto, Buildroot, or Open Embedded.
  • Experience with performance optimization and advanced troubleshooting at kernel-level.
  • Experience with memory managed high performance ARM Cortex-A or X86 architectures and SoCs (NXP, Freescale, Intel, AMD, Xilinx, Altera, …).
  • Experience with the Linux kernel itself or the kernel of any other operating system with strictly isolated kernel and user spaces.
  • Proven success with root-cause investigation of bugs related to operating systems, hypervisors, or hardware-level drivers.
  • Proficiency in the C programming language
  • Proficiency with Git at a command line level
  • Ability to track and work on multiple projects simultaneously while meeting schedules.
  • Demonstrated experience of leading software projects while providing technical inputs to unblock supporting teams.
  • Keen sense of urgency and drive for results.
  • Ability to work independently with minimal oversight.
  • Over and above, a deep commitment to your own quality work and a strong desire to help the entire team to succeed.
  • Must be a US citizen or US person.

 

Applicant must have proven, extensive depth of knowledge in one or more of the following categories:

  1. New Linux kernel driver development.

        Must be able to read electrical schematics well enough to understand pin configuration procedures and digital logic levels.

        Must be able to read integrated circuit data sheets and understand register configuration procedures.

        Must understand interrupts and how to appropriately use them to our advantage

        Must understand when and how to appropriately use DMA to our advantage

  1. Operating System core kernel development experience

        Must have experience with scheduling and timing-related mechanisms and issues in any of the OS kernels as described above

        Must have extensive understanding with context switching, preemption, interrupts, timers, and locking mechanisms.

        Must have knowledge of Unix-style file-system data structures (inodes, …)

        Must have knowledge of page tables and memory management.

        Must have cursory knowledge of assembly level bootstrapping in either ARM or X86 instruction sets.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
